Professor Taihyun Chang of POSTECH Department of Chemistry was elected as a fellow of the American Physical Society (APS). To be elected as a fellow, one must be a member of APS with outstanding academic achievements. It is only awarded to the erudite scholars accounting for 0.5 % of the total number of APS members.
Prof. Chang specializes in various detection techniques such as High-Performance Liquid Chromatography. Using these techniques he succeeded in separating and analyzing polymers very precisely, which had not been possible before. He created a sensation for developing a new technique to analyze block midair polymers by individual blocks. With this precise method, he has churned out scientific results on rheological characteristics of nonlinear polymers.
